Tom Tresser presented on the future of arts and business collaboration at the TedxMich Avenue event on May 8, 2011. The entire event was devoted to investigating the future of the arts in America. http://www.tresser.com

Eric and Jon of AKIRA

• First, loose everything

• Never eat alone – make everyone a friend, “love everybody

• Minimize risk but take risks and then go all out

• Hire for Energy, Intelligence and Integrity – with Integrity being MOST important

• Seek and revel in inspiration (travel, design, deviants)

• Create a creative environment for creative people and then trust them and support them
